AUTHORIZATION OF THE SERVICE


The 1st referee authorizes the service, after having checked that the two teams are ready to play and that the server is in possession of the ball.

12.4
EXECUTION OF THE SERVICE

12.4.1
The ball shall be hit with one hand or any part of the arm after being tossed or released from the hand(s).

12.4.2
Only one toss or release of the ball is allowed. Dribbling or moving the ball in the hands is permitted.

12.4.3
At the moment of the service hit or take-off for a jump service, the server must not touch the court (the end line included) or the floor outside the service zone.
1.4.2, 27.2.1.4, D11 (22),
D12 (4)

After the hit, he/she may step or land outside the service zone, or inside the court.

12.4.4
The server must hit the ball within 8 seconds after the 1st referee whistles for service.
12.3, D11 (11)
12.4.5
A service executed before the referee's whistle is cancelled and repeated.
